2 Lexie Mullen

  • Position Infield
  • Height 5-7
  • Class Senior
  • High School Daviess County
  • Hometown Owensboro, Ky.

Biography

2020:
  • Started all 21 games 
  • Academic All-District Team 
  • Finished with a .323 batting average with 21 hits, 2 doubles, and 4 homeruns
  • Brought in 8 runs and 8 RBI's
  • Posted a .538 slugging percentage 
2019:
  • Academic All-GMAC
  • NFCA 2nd Team All-Region
  • Played and started in a team-high of all 48 games
  • Finished with a .303 batting average with 9 doubles, 1 triple, and 9 homeruns
  • Brought in 43 RBIs and 18 runs
  • Led the team in homeruns and RBIs
  • Stole 1 base
  • Posted a .933 average in the field
2018:
  • Played in 54 games, starting every one of them.
  • Finished with a .380 batting average with 14 doubles, 2 triples, and 8 homeruns
  • Led the team in doubles and knocked-in a career and team-best 51 RBIs
  • Produced a team-high .615 slugging percentage
  • Defensively finished the year with a .941 fielding percentage
  • Recorded 20 multi-hit games including a five for five day on May 3rd in the G-MAC Tournament against Ohio Dominican. Her day consisted of 2 doubles, 3 RBIs, and 2 runs scored.
  • Posted 14 multi-RBIs games with a career-high 4 RBIs on March 27th against Trevecca.
  • First Team All-GMAC
2017:
  • Started all 60 games.
  • Finished with a .295 batting average with 11 doubles, 11 homeruns and 48 RBIs.
  • Scored 34 runs.
  • Finished second on the team with 48 RBIs.
  • Four times posted 3 hits in a game, including a three for four day with 2 doubles and 3 RBIs on May 7th against Davis & Elkins.
  • Drove in 4 runs during a two for four day with a homerun against Trevecca on May 6th.
  • Produced 17 multi-hit games.
  • First Team All-GMAC
Daviess County High School: Five-year letter winner and four-year starter at pitcher and second base…coached by John Biggs. Senior—2016 Honorable Mention All-State selection…All-Third Region choice…All-Ninth District honoree…named All-Big Eight Conference…chosen All-Area by Messenger-Inquirer…selected to All-City/County squad…member of East-West All-Stars and Kentucky All-Stars…started all 44 games played…hit .394…posted a .613 slugging percentage…had 56 hits in 142 at bats…produced 12 doubles, two triples and five home runs…drove in 54 runs…stole three bases…scored 35 runs…made six starts on the mound…compiled a 1.83 ERA…turned in a 4-2 record…completed four games…had one shutout…threw 23 innings…registered 14 strikeouts. Junior—2015 All-Third Region choice…All-Ninth District honoree…named All-Big Eight Conference…chosen All-Area by Messenger-Inquirer…selected to All-City/County squad…started 40 straight contests…batted .346…produced a .638 slugging percentage…collected 45 hits in 130 plate appearances…recorded 11 doubles, three triples and seven home runs…knocked in 54 runs…scored 21 runs…pitched 27 contests with 19 starts…had a 12-4 record…threw 14 complete games…had three shutouts…threw 104 innings…registered a no-hitter and two, one-hit games…totaled 31 strikeouts. Sophomore—2014 All-Ninth District honoree…selected to All-City/County squad…started all 22 games played…hit .469…amassed a .641 slugging percentage…totaled 30 hits in 64 plate appearances…compiled seven doubles, two triples and one home run…knocked in 14 RBIs…stole five bases…scored 11 runs…had a 2.92 ERA…pitched 14 games with 12 starts…won three contests…completed two contests…had one shutout…tossed 48 innings…recorded 15 strikeouts…posted a no-hitter and three one-hitters. Freshman—Batted .309…had 17 hits in 55 at bats…tallied five doubles and one home run…batted in nine runs…stole one base…scored three runs…threw 17 contests with 14 starts and six wins…had a 3.74 ERA…tossed four complete games and one shutout…totaled 76.2 innings…fanned 21 batters…had a no-hitter and three one hitters. Career—Hit .379 and had a .595 slugging percentage…started 129 straight games…ripped 149 hits in 410 at bats…posted 35 doubles, seven triples and 14 home runs…recorded 131 RBIs…stole 10 bases…score 70 runs…registered a 3.39 ERA…pitched 71 contests with 67 starts and 26 wins…threw 20 complete games and six shutouts…notched 278 strikeouts…posted 88 strikeouts…recorded three no-hitters and eight one-hit games. Academics: National Honor Society inductee.
 
Lexie is the daughter of James Mullen and Misty Simmons.  She has two brother and three sisters.  Her major is Elementary Education.
